spirithawk • 27 September 2012 at 8:17 PM
@izzfred This happens when you're using a character that cannot be in usernames. Like:~ ` ! @ # $ % ^ & * ( ) + = [ { } ] \ | : ; " ' < , > . / ? Even though you might have not seen it, you might have accidentally typed in one of those characters. 😉

yukihitsugaya • 28 September 2012 at 5:13 PM
@izzfred screenshots on mac work by holding down:command - shift - 3The screenshot will show up on the desktop after using this command.
